Background
Wright State University, established in 1967, is a public research institution located in Dayton, Ohio. The university's mission is to transform the lives of students and the communities it serves by providing exceptional education, conducting meaningful research, and engaging in community service. Its vision is to be a catalyst for educational innovation, economic development, and social mobility. Wright State offers a comprehensive range of undergraduate and graduate programs across various disciplines, including engineering, business, liberal arts, and health sciences. The university is recognized for its commitment to accessibility, affordability, and fostering a diverse and inclusive environment.

Financials and Funding
As a public institution, Wright State University receives funding from state appropriations, tuition and fees, research grants, and private donations. The university has faced financial challenges in recent years, leading to budget restructuring and cost-saving measures. Efforts are ongoing to stabilize finances through increased enrollment, enhanced fundraising activities, and efficient resource management.

Competitor Analysis
Wright State University operates in a competitive landscape that includes:
- University of Dayton: A private institution known for its strong engineering and business programs.
- Miami University: A public university recognized for its liberal arts education and research initiatives.
- Ohio State University: A major public research university with extensive resources and a broad range of programs.
These competitors offer similar programs and are actively engaged in research and community partnerships, posing challenges and opportunities for Wright State University.
Strategic Collaborations and Partnerships
Wright State University has established significant collaborations to enhance its offerings:
- Air Force Research Laboratory: Joint research projects in aerospace and defense technologies.
- Premier Health: Partnerships for medical research and clinical training opportunities for students.
- Local Industries: Engagements with companies in the Dayton area to provide internships and cooperative education experiences.
